Deadbolt Won't Extend Into the Frame
You turn the key or the thumb-turn but the bolt barely moves or won't go all the way in. Usually the door has shifted and the bolt is hitting the frame instead of sliding into the hole. We realign things so it extends fully.
Door Swings Open On Its Own
You close the door but it doesn't stay shut - the latch isn't catching the strike plate. The spring inside may be broken, or the plate has shifted. Either way, your door isn't secured and we fix that.
Key Turns But Nothing Happens
The key spins freely without resistance - something inside has disconnected. A small part called the tailpiece or cam has broken. We open it up, replace the broken part, and reconnect everything.
You Have to Slam or Lift the Door to Lock It
If locking your door requires body weight or lifting the handle, the alignment is off. This gets worse over time and eventually the lock will fail completely. We fix the alignment now before that happens.

Can every broken lock be repaired, or do some need replacing?
Most can be repaired. But if the main body is cracked or it's a cheap lock that's worn through, replacement is sometimes the better value. We'll tell you honestly which makes more sense for your situation.
Why do I have to lift my door to get the deadbolt to lock?
Your door or frame has shifted - usually from the house settling over time. The bolt hole in the frame no longer lines up with the bolt. We move the strike plate so everything aligns again.
Do you carry parts or will I have to wait for an order?
We carry the most common parts - springs, latches, cams, and tailpieces for popular brands like Schlage and Kwikset. Most repairs are completed in a single visit.
How long does a typical repair take?
Once on site, most repairs take 30-60 minutes including diagnosis, the fix, and testing. Complex commercial hardware might take a bit longer.
Is it worth repairing a cheap lock or should I just get a new one?
If it's a basic builder-grade lock that's already failed, we usually recommend upgrading to something better rather than spending money fixing something that wasn't great to begin with.
